A current account is an account where the level of activity is far more than savings. It is often referred to as a check in account and is made to do frequent transactions as a result most of the times it does not have balance in it. In such cases, current account in banks in does not offer any interest on the account balance . They are 0 interest accounts.

Where can you find subscription receivable in the balance sheet?

Whether Subscription Receivable account should be presented as an current asset or a contra equity account is debatable. The US SEC requires it as a contra equity account.

Are installment account receivables a current asset or liability?

Account receivables are always assets. It's money that is owed to you by another. The length of time in which that money is expected to be collected determines whether it's a current asset or long term asset.

How do you get overdraft in bank?

You can go to any bank that you have a bank account with and ask for an overdraft account. Whether or not they give you an OD facility depends on the following factors: a. The type of bank account you have b. Your history with the bank c. Your monthly salary d. Whether your salary gets credited to this account e. Can you provide collateral like Fixed Deposit or Gold etc. The chances of getting an overdraft are significantly higher for people having a salary account and even higher for people who can provide collateral.
